Output 7945dcba4649899c5f352f3d061cd10738b42b375b67a577ce808cef5bf64df8:0

value
19763
script pubkey
OP_0 OP_PUSHBYTES_20 f8f58fbe2cfb15233adc4d7142e61183f36fc372
address
bc1qlr6cl03vlv2jxwkuf4c59es3s0eklsmjfzyaua
transaction
7945dcba4649899c5f352f3d061cd10738b42b375b67a577ce808cef5bf64df8
confirmations
178477
spent
true